[with patch, positive review] implement additive_order for elliptic curve points
Description
sage: E = EllipticCurve(GF(5),[1..5]) sage: P = E.lift_x(0) sage: P (0 : 2 : 1) sage: P.additive_order() --------------------------------------------------------------------------- <type 'exceptions.NotImplementedError'> Traceback (most recent call last) /Users/was/papers/submitted/kolyconj/<ipython console> in <module>() /Users/was/papers/submitted/kolyconj/element.pyx in sage.structure.element.ModuleElement.additive_order() <type 'exceptions.NotImplementedError'>: sage: P.order() 3
Fine.
Maybe David Loeffler, working on abelian groups, wants this differently.
By now, this should go in.
chris.
Done: I defined additive_order to be a synonym for order (in 3 places) with relevant doctests.